I am in central NJ near the coast. We had about 12 inches. 8-9 of that was snow. Then it changed to rain which we had about 3-4 inches of ice on top of the snow. The community has a crew to shovel the majority of it but I had to do some followup cleanup. I had to use a metal garden shovel to break through the top layer of ice, chop it off, then shovel it away then I could shovel the layer of snow. These pictures are today, a week later so there was some compression, but not much melting since its been below 25 the whole week. Might warm up some mid next week.
You can see the layer of ice.
This is more snow than we had in the last few years combined.Comment
